The League of Mediocre Gamers is a Halo 3 gaming club for all players up to the rank of Force Colonel. Now I realize that there might be some Colonels out there who take offense to being called 'mediocre' but in the grand scheme of things I consider Colonel the top of the chain before going into what could be considered 'pro gamer' territory. If you're a Colonel then you know the road to 45 and Brigadier is a long one. But back on point, the LoMG is a Halo 3 club. Kind of like MLG for scrubs. The LoMG has it's own map and game types, and in the near future is going to start setting up ladders for tournaments. We're also going to offer lessons and training services.. -The only games played in LoMG are Team Slayer (TS) and Capture the Flag (CTF).

-We are working on our own call out maps based on the territories game type. They aren't as specific as MLG call outs, but for good reason. Newer players will have an easier time with a simple number system, and less areas to memorize. This will be good experience, and will make learning for advanced and specific call outs easier to pick up as you advance your level of playing.
